如何在 VS Code 代码片段中插入制表符?

3

我在VS Code中有一段代码片段,看起来像这样

"JS arrow function": {
    "scope": "javascript, typescript",
    "prefix": "af",
    "body": [
        "const ${1:name} = (${2:props}) => {",
        "   $3",
        "}"
    ],
    "description": "Create arrow function"
}

我希望在第三个制表位之前有一个制表符`tabulation`,但是VS Code显示错误:字符串中有无效字符。控制字符必须转义。同时,在`$3`之前加入4个空格可以正常工作,但我需要在我的eslint配置中确切地使用制表符`tabulation`。是否有一种方法可以在那里使用制表符呢?
1个回答

12

\t

那是转义的制表符。
"JS arrow function": {
    "scope": "javascript, typescript",
    "prefix": "af",
    "body": [
        "const ${1:name} = (${2:props}) => {",
        "\t$3",
        "}"
    ],
    "description": "Create arrow function"
}

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接